Rated 5 out of 5 stars
Great watch that encourages more activity
|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.My son has been asking us for a smartwatch because he lost his previous watch. He is 12 years old and we are trying to get him to be more active, but we also wanted something to help keep him safe. We came across the Fitbit Ace LTE and decided to give it a try. The watch came with a wristband, the actual watch itself, and a protective cover. The wristband is great because it is a soft velcro band that is soft around his wrist and easy to put on. The initial setup of the watch was incredibly fast. You choose the service plant that you want (monthly or yearly subscription), link it to your account, and it's ready to be used. The service plans are affordable, and at the moment, they have discounted deals for service. After the parent setup the watch with a paid account, hand it over to your child so he can create/choose his/her character and personalize the watch face to their liking. You will also have the option to setup Tap to Pay for them in the future (not yet available). The calls are great. They are clear and easy to hear. I was worried that there would be too much background noise, being that he is speaking through his watch, but I am able to hear him clearly, and I come through clear for him as well. He also has the ability to text from his watch, which can be a little difficult since the watchface isn't very big. But he manages to text us fine. The watch apps encourage him to be more active through games and move goals. Best of all, the watch is water resistant so he doesn't have to worry about removing the watch when he is washing his hands. As for safety purposes, I am able to track him wherever he goes. It alse serves to help find the watch, which we were not able to do with his previous more affordable watch. Another big plus is that we are able to keep track of his fitness activity. Everything is controlled via the Fitbit Ace app. Overall, we are very happy with the Fitbit Ace. My son is enjoying it, and I am happy that we are able to keep him safe with it by monitoring his location. I would highly recommend the Fitbit Ace to parents.

Rated 4 out of 5 stars
Great watch for keeping track of your child!
|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.The Fitbit Ace LTE smartwatch is a great tool to not only help motivate your child to be active, but also to keep track of your child when they are on the go! First of all, the watch looks cool. My child can be picky, so anything that doesn't look the part won't get worn. For him to wear it, in my opinion, shows that the watch has great aesthetics! The ability to call and text from the watch works great! My child finds it fun to send me emojis and, honestly, it is easier for him to send me a voice text message then it is for him to try to type out a message on the watch. The call quality is clear and distortion free on both ends of the call. The watch attempts to make being active fun. From different games on the watch, to different screen animations that show how active my child has been, it is a very versatile watch that really tries to get on the child's level to attract them to be more active. My son enjoyed playing the games in order to earn points to decorate his "room" on his watch. My only annoyances with this watch are that, in order to add a contact to the watch for your child to be able to talk/text with, that contact must 1) have a gmail account and 2) must download the Fitbit Ace App, and in order to unlock more features or new games, you must purchase new watch bands. The app is the only way to communicate with the watch. Essentially, the watch does not have a phone number that can be given out to family and friends. All interaction is done through the phone app. I understand this is part of the process of keeping your child safe and knowing who they are contacting, but it is an inconvenient process when dealing with each individual person and trying to get them to download the app and sign up for a gmail account. In order to unlock new games or features, you must purchase additional watch bands for the watch. They aren't completely necessary, but it is something to consider. For these reasons, I gave the watch 4 stars instead of 5. This watch has a LTE data plan that needs to be purchased either monthly or yearly. When you consider the features of this watch and the price of the LTE plan, I feel the price is very reasonable! There is also an incoming feature to allow your child to use the watch to pay for items using NFC/Google Pay, however, that feature was not available at the time I received the watch and wrote this review. Other than the listed caveats above, this watch is a great item to keep contact with your child and to motivate your child to be active!

No, I would not recommend this to a friendRated 4 out of 5 stars
Kid loves it
|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.I honestly didn't think this was a good thing for my kid at first. I just thought it would be one more thing that he'd leave laying around once he was bored with it...but it this has not been the case. He love his fit bit. The good - It's pretty easy to set up. My kid and I set it up in about 10 minutes. We did have a few issues where we kept getting switch back to what I assumed was German but we got it figured out. After syncing to my phone, everything else was pretty easy. He constantly tracks his steps and activity and watches the "noodle" or snake as he calls it. He seems to be pretty happy with the games as well. The texting and calling features work pretty well. I can hear him clearly and he can hear me as well. He's pretty good at texting on it as well. The app it straight forward and simple to use as well. The charger has a usb-c type plug so we had to get him a charging block for that but not a big deal. It hasn't replaced his phone but he definitely seems to pay more attention having the fitbit on and charged than he does his phone. The negative - my main issue with it is that you have to have a gmail/Google account to able to added as a contact. I get it but it's a little limiting. Had to create a gmail account for his mother and his grandmother. Not a huge deal but still limiting.
